AI/SMART GLASSES & REQUIRED TESTING: As Smart/AI Glasses become more popular with students, we want to ensure that students and parents understand the appropriate use of these devices during upcoming state testing. Please keep the following guidelines in mind:
-
Devices with internet access or camera/video capabilities are not permitted during testing, as per Texas Education Agency guidelines.
-
Students may wear Smart/AI Glasses for vision reasons as long as they do not access image or video capture functions.
-
If the glasses are not needed for vision, we recommend leaving them at home on testing days.
-
Capturing images or videos of test screens is strictly prohibited and can be traced back to individual students.
-
Disciplinary action may be taken if a student is found violating these guidelines, which could include the test being voided, resulting in a missed opportunity to pass the required assessment.

- CONGRATULATIONS to Color Guard for winning the National A Class State Championship at the North Texas Colorguard Association (NTCA) Championships on March 29-30. They also made history this past week, April 3-5, by being the first Melissa team ever to compete at the Winter Guard International (WGI) World Championships in Dayton, Ohio, where they finished in 2nd place!
- CONGRATULATIONS to the One Act Play cast and crew for advancing to the area round of competition with their play “Where Words Once Were.” They performed at the UIL bi-district contest on April 3 and received the following awards: Outstanding Technician (Lights): Sincere Lewis; Honorable Mention All Star Cast: Sam Barton as Teacher; Logan Venner as Isaac; All Star Cast: Paden Davidson as Orhan; Halle Heywood as Alli. The area contest will be April 12 at Frisco Emerson High School.
